Step-by-step guide

  1. 1

    Step 1: Create an account on Bitget

    Visit Bitget via our referral link and sign up. Click the Register button and enter your email and password. This takes about 2 minutes.

    Open account Bitget
  2. 2

    Step 2: Complete identity verification (KYC)

    Upload a photo of your passport or driver's license and take a selfie. KYC typically takes 5 minutes to a few hours. Without verification the exchange limits withdrawals.

  3. 3

    Step 3: Deposit funds

    Transfer USDT, USDC, or fiat to the exchange. You can buy crypto directly with a bank card on the platform or transfer from another wallet.

  4. 4

    Step 4: Find the PancakeSwap trading pair

    Go to the Spot or Trade section and search for the CAKE/USDT or CAKE/BTC pair. Type the coin name in the search bar.

  5. 5

    Step 5: Place a buy order

    Choose an order type: market (instant, at current price) or limit (at your target price). Enter the USDT amount or PancakeSwap quantity and confirm the order.

Fees

Bitget charges a spot trading fee of 0.1% for both maker and taker orders. Holding BGB can provide discounts on these fees. The platform's copy trading feature allows you to replicate the trades of successful traders, and BGB holders enjoy additional fee reductions.

FAQ

How to buy PancakeSwap on Bitget?

Sign up on Bitget, complete KYC, deposit funds, and buy PancakeSwap in the Spot trading section using the PancakeSwap/USDT pair.

What are the fees for buying PancakeSwap on Bitget?

The standard fee on Bitget is 0.1% for makers and 0.1% for takers. Fees may decrease when you pay with the exchange native token or reach higher trading volume tiers.

Is Bitget safe for buying crypto?

Bitget is a licensed centralized exchange with multi-layer account security. Enable two-factor authentication (2FA) and avoid keeping large amounts on the exchange long-term.

Can I buy PancakeSwap with USD or EUR on Bitget?

Yes, Bitget supports fiat purchases (USD, EUR, and others). Use the Quick Buy section or pay with a bank card.
